Learn How to Solve AEC Problems with Python!

This Code with Me course is designed for architects and engineers with no prior programming experience, besides an interest in learning to code.

What Participants Say About the Course

A good introduction backed up by an instructor with relevant experience and knowledge.
Previous Student
I recently had the privilege of attending Christian Kongsgaard’s Python for Architects and Engineers course, and I can’t recommend it highly enough.
Previous Student
In this course you will learn basic coding literacy that will get you started on the path of becoming proficient with code. As with all languages it takes time to become fluent, but after these 3 days I feel more confident to get started and start experimenting.
Márton Fehér
Construction Architect
Christian doesn’t just teach Python; he brings a thoughtful and visionary approach to everything he does.
Previous Student
The 3-day structure helped to focus on different levels of understanding and application. Each day felt like reaching a new milestone, and having the next day to build on the next steps was a good course structure. Definitely much more confident and prepared to take a dive into the world of Python and coding now
Previous Participant
Christian Konggaard’s “Python Coding for Architects and Engineers” course is something I can truly recommend to anyone in the construction industry who is curious about coding and wants to understand how it can support our work.
Wanlika Kaewkamchand
Architect & BIM Specialist

Upcoming Courses

Waiting List

Waiting List

  • Want to be notified when the next course location is released?

Learn Programming Python In-Person

This is an introduction course to coding in Python for AEC professionals.

If you have no programming experience or just a little bit, then this course is for you. It will take you through the fundamentals, such as loops and if/else statements.

Practical and Hands-On

You will learn practical skills and do so by coding exercises yourself.

100% Python

The whole course will be focused on Python.

In-Person Training

The course is taught in-person.

AEC Focused

We will focus on skills, concepts and exercises applicable to the AEC industry.

Tangible Outcomes

We will work with tangible problems and the course material can be used afterwards.

Code Like a Pro

You will learn programming concepts and workflows.

This is Christian

He is going to teach this course.

Christian Kongsgaard

Hey there, I'm Christian.

I'm an architectural engineer, turned full-stack developer.

I have since 2018 been working with developing software for engineers and architects, both in-house and as a consultant.

I am largely a self-taught programmer (took a single programming course in Python on my exchange). My first programming language was Python, and I have since then learned and coded with JavaScript, TypeScript, C#, and Rust.

I have extensive experience with creating Revit and Grasshopper plugins, building web apps, building physics and LCA.

Ready to Dive into Python?

Unlock your full potential and start the journey towards becoming an AEC coding master!